This hotel is a real gem, a rural quinta with real character located almost in the centre of the historic and charming town of Tavira. The rooms are individual apartments created from traditional algarvean farm cottages located within beautiful gardens which are full of interesting places to sit and relax. The rustic nature of the cottages does rather extend to the plumbing. There is some noise (not serious) from the nearby railway station. Some development appears to be taking place around the outside of the property, which may eventually detract from its ambience. |
